椰子油对海南黑山羊羔羊瘤胃氢代谢、甲烷生成及相关酶活性的影响

Abstract
试验旨在研究椰子油对羔羊瘤胃氢代谢、甲烷生成及相关酶活性的影响.选用24只10日龄、体重(2.05±0.16)kg的海南黑山羊羔羊(公母各半),随机分成4组,每组6只重复,分别添加0、4、6、8 g/d椰子油,试验期60 d.结果表明:与对照组相比,添加椰子油能够降低羔羊瘤胃液中溶解H2(dH2)浓度(P<0.05),6 g/d和8 g/d椰子油组溶解CH4(dCH4)均降低(P<0.05),4 g/d和8 g/d椰子油组瘤胃pH升高(P<0.05),6 g/d和8 g/d的椰子油能够增加还原型烟酰胺腺嘌呤二核苷酸(NADH)、烟酰胺腺嘌呤二核苷酸磷酸(NADP+)/还原型烟酰胺腺嘌呤二核苷酸磷酸(NADPH)浓度(P<0.05),瘤胃液中乳酸脱氢酶(LDH)活性增强(P<0.05);椰子油组羔羊瘤胃液中琥珀酸脱氢酶(SDH)活性增强(P<0.05),8 g/d椰子油还可增加羔羊丙酮酸脱氢酶活性(PDH)(P<0.05),添加椰子油对瘤胃微生物蛋白、氧化还原电位、NADH氧化酶、苹果酸脱氢酶(MDH)和羟酯酰辅酶A脱氢酶(AADH)活性无影响(P>0.05).结果提示,添加6~8 g/d椰子油能降低羔羊瘤胃液中dCH4和dH2分压浓度,使NADH、NADP+和NADPH浓度显著升高,增强LDH、PDH和SDH活性,改变瘤胃发酵中间氢的传递,从而抑制瘤胃甲烷的生成.
